Kinds Of Fireplaces Available
When checking out a fireplace store, clients will come across different types of fireplaces. Understanding these options can help in choosing the best one for a home.
1. Wood-Burning Fireplaces
- Description: Traditional type that utilizes wood logs as fuel.
- Advantages:
- Offers a classic atmosphere and the crackling sound of burning wood.
- Can be more cost-effective in areas plentiful in wood supply.
2. Gas Fireplaces
- Description: Uses gas or gas and ignites with the flip of a switch.
- Benefits:
- Easier to operate and maintain than wood-burning models.
- Offers a consistent heat output and can be more energy-efficient.
3. Electric Fireplaces
- Description: Uses electrical energy to create heat and create a flame effect.
- Advantages:
- Requires no venting, making setup simpler.
- Deals different settings for flame and heat strength.
4. Gel Fuel Fireplaces
- Description: Uses gel fuel cylinders to produce a real flame without venting.
- Advantages:
- Portable and simple to install.
- No need for a chimney or gas line.
5. Ethanol Fireplaces
- Description: Burns bioethanol fuel, providing a genuine flame.
- Advantages:
- Environmentally friendly without any smoke or ash.
- Can be utilized inside your home or outdoors.
Fireplace Type | Fuel Source | Vent Requirement | Installation Cost | Upkeep |
---|---|---|---|---|
Wood-Burning | Wood | Yes | Moderate | High |
Gas | Natural Gas/Propane | Yes (or optional) | Low | Low |
Electric | Electrical energy | No | Low | Very Low |
Gel Fuel | Gel Fuel | No | Extremely Low | Extremely Low |
Ethanol | Bioethanol | No | Low | Low |
Aspects to Consider When Shopping
When going to a fireplace store, a number of aspects need to be taken into consideration before buying:
- Space: Measure the area where the fireplace will be installed to guarantee the selected design fits comfortably.
- Heating Needs: Assess the square video of the space to identify the needed heat output.
- Design: Choose a fireplace that complements existing décor, whether it's rustic, modern, or traditional.
- Budget: Set a budget that consists of both the system's purchase and installation costs.
- Regional Regulations: Check local structure codes concerning fireplace installation to ensure compliance.
Frequently Asked Questions About Fireplace Stores
1. What is the best type of fireplace for a home?
The "best" type depends upon the homeowner's needs and preferences. Gas fireplaces are popular for their benefit, while wood-burning fireplaces provide a traditional experience.

3. Are electric fireplaces safe?
Yes, electric fireplaces are normally considered safe. They do not produce real flames or emissions, minimizing the risks associated with traditional fireplaces.
4. How do I preserve my fireplace?
Maintenance varies by type. Wood-burning designs require cleansing of the chimney and flue, while gas fireplaces might require annual assessments. Electric fireplaces typically need minimal maintenance.
5. Can I set up a fireplace myself?
While some electric and gel fireplaces can be set up as DIY tasks, it's normally best to employ specialists for gas and wood-burning fireplaces to ensure security and compliance with building regulations.
